Difficulties

"Everything difficult indicates something more than our theory of life yet embraces, checks some tendency to abandon the straight path, leaving open only the way ahead. But there is a reality of being in which all things are easy and plain - oneness, that is, with the Lord of Life; to pray for this is the first thing; and to the point of this prayer every difficulty hedges and directs us." - George MacDonald

I have been consumed by this devotion this week. A friend handed me an anthology of readings of George MacDonald. MacDonald was a Scotsman whom C.S. Lewis said influenced everything he wrote.

This week this man, who died in 1905, is influencing me.
